Mining equipment is specialized machinery and tools used during the extraction, transport, and processing of minerals, metals, and earth materials from the surface of the Earth. Excavators, drills, loaders, crushers, and other mining equipment are important tools used in the process of mining.
The rise in international demand for natural resources due to accelerating industrialization and urbanization is broadening the international mining sector and, in turn, improving opportunities in the mining equipment sector. Industry players are increasing manufacturing capacities to keep pace with the increased demand for different categories of equipment such as crushers, mining drills, screening equipment, and mineral processing machinery.
The focus on electric vehicle electrification by car companies is also fueling mining equipment demand. A major hindrance to market expansion, though, is the higher price of mining equipment because of technology improvements, increased fuel costs, and contemporary machinery parts.
Market Drivers
Growing demand for minerals and metals
A surge in the number of infrastructure development projects all over the world, particularly emerging economies like China, India, South Africa and Brazil are placing increasing demands for minerals like iron ore, limestone, and copper.
Additionally, the increase in urban and industrial activities further creates an increased demand for metals such as copper, lithium, and nickel, important for use in electronics, electric vehicles, and renewable energy technologies, hence increasing the demand for mining equipment.
Technological advances and automation
Technological improvements like the adoption of state–of-the-art automation are a central drivers for the worldwide mining equipment market. Additionally, automation, remote monitoring, and data analysis are important functions in increasing the efficiency, safety, and productivity of mining operations.
Advanced mining equipment comes with a provision for sensors, GPS, and connectivity, facilitating real-time monitoring and control, it increases operational efficiency, as well as helping to raise standards of safety, and cost reduction. An example of such technology is Chirp, which is a wireless communication technology used alongside GPS and LiDAR.
Market Restraints
High capital investment
The high front-end expenditures on acquiring and deploying sophisticated mining machinery are a market constraint. Capital intensity of the industry, coupled with the significant costs involved in operations and maintenance, is a major hindrance.
Due to heavy investments in equipment, infrastructure, and operating costs, the mining equipment industry is challenging for small businesses, especially. This difference in economic ability hinders the competitiveness of small and medium-sized mining enterprises against their bigger counterparts, hence affecting the growth pattern of the mining equipment market.
Mining Equipment Market Regional Insight
Geographically, the market of mining equipment has been classified under Asia-Pacific, Europe, North America, Middle East & Africa and Latin America. Asia-Pacific region accounted for the majority in the world in 2022 with 37.5% market share in 2022 and will maintain its leadership position during the forecast period.
China is a major consumer and producer of coal and other metals, and it has a huge influence on the mining equipment industry. Governments and mining organizations are investing in newer technologies like AI and IoT to maximize the extraction of resources and minimize environmental footprint.
Moreover, there is a rising focus on sustainable mining, prompted by strict environmental regulations. The region‘s rising demand for metals and minerals, spurred by urbanization and infrastructure development, is driving investments in advanced mining equipment.
Partnerships with technology suppliers and a move towards green solutions are some of the major trends in the changing dynamics of the Asia Pacific mining equipment market.
The Indian mining equipment sector continued its robust growth pace in 2022. The sector recorded a remarkable growth of 26% in 2023 with overall volumes exceeding the one lakh unit mark. The sector was led by the improvement in the overall macroeconomic scenario and a robust recovery in construction activity.
